Compensation & Benefits
This role is based in the US and offers a hiring range in USD from $96,800 to $251,600 per year. May be eligible for bonus, equity, and compensation deferral. Oracle maintains broad salary ranges to account for variations in knowledge, skills, experience, market conditions, and locations, as well as differing products, industries, and lines of business. Candidates are typically placed into the range based on the preceding factors as well as internal peer equity.
Oracle US offers a comprehensive benefits package which includes:
- Medical, dental, and vision insurance, including expert medical opinion
- Short term disability and long term disability
- Life insurance and AD&D
- Supplemental life insurance (Employee/Spouse/Child)
- Health care and dependent care Flexible Spending Accounts
- Pre-tax commuter and parking benefits
- 401(k) Savings and Investment Plan with company match
- Paid time off: Flexible Vacation is provided to all eligible employees assigned to a salaried (non-overtime eligible) position. Accrued Vacation is provided to all other employees eligible for vacation benefits. For employees working at least 35 hours per week, the vacation accrual rate is 13 days annually for the first three years of employment and 18 days annually for subsequent years of employment. Vacation accrual is prorated for employees working between 20 and 34 hours per week. Employees working fewer than 20 hours per week are not eligible for vacation.
- 11 paid holidays
- Paid sick leave: 72 hours of paid sick leave upon date of hire. Refreshes each calendar year. Unused balance will carry over each year up to a maximum cap of 112 hours.
